Algorithm and Architecture of a Low-Complexity and High-Parallelism Preprocessing-Based K -Best Detector for Large-Scale MIMO Systems. |
Abstract | ||
---|---|---|
As a branch of sphere decoding, the K-best method has played an important role in detection in large-scale multiple-input-multiple-output (MIMO) systems. However, as the numbers of users and antennas grow, the preprocessing complexity increases significantly, which is one of the major issues with the K-best method.
